News stories on true crimes often include in their headlines a short summation of the primary person being accused and their origin state. It’s not unusual to see headlines including phrases such as “California woman” or “Washington man.”

It just so happens that headlines with the phrase “Florida man” seemed to involve increasingly strange cases. These headlines gained notoriety when @_FloridaMan began accumulating them on Twitter. It’s at this intersection of reality and general internet hilarity that the Florida man was born.

Memes of the Florida Man quickly became an internet sensation due to the plethora of outlandish news stories from Florida. This has often made the very idea of the Florida Man feel more like a sensational internet concept than a real person.

Case Status

The owner of the home mistook the child’s paintball gun for a real gun. So, he ran out to defend his family by firing his own weapon. This may or may not have led to Williams running his son over with his car.

While Williams took the child home, it was the mother that notified the Opa-Locka police. But Williams has been charged for child neglect with great bodily harm. Authorities have yet to release further details of the child’s current condition.
